Governors State University’s College of Business seeks to create an available pool of Adjunct Faculty candidates to teach courses in Management. The major responsibilities of an adjunct faculty member are to teach courses such as Human Resource Management, Compensation Administration, Labor Relations, Training and Development, Entrepreneurial Accounting and Finance and Organizational Behavior. Adjunct faculty should be able to support their course online and use appropriate software tools.

Interested individuals are invited to complete a faculty profile, attach a curriculum vitae, cover letter, and transcripts for consideration.

At Governors State University, adjunct faculty are hired as temporary faculty with teaching responsibilities for a specific course in a semester or summer session. Adjuncts are not a part of the faculty bargaining unit and are not included in membership of the Faculty Senate.
